§ 841(a)(1), commonly referred to as Possession With Intent to Distribute. Anyone who is found in possession of a large amount of counterfeit or controlled substances could be charged with this crime, which is a more serious offense than possession of controlled substances (a/k/a street drugs) for personal use.

US Code Title 21 Section 846. Any person who attempts or conspires to commit any offense defined in this subchapter shall be subject to the same penalties as those prescribed for the offense, the commission of which was the object of the attempt or conspiracy. (Pub.

Is There a Statute of Limitations on Drug Charges? The statute of limitations for drug conspiracy charges varies state by state. However, under the federal drug conspiracy law of 21 U.S.C. Section 846, the government must bring drug charges within five years of committing the crime.
